Engineering Manager - API at Twilio (San Francisco, CA)

$
0
0

At Twilio, APIs are our business. Our core customers are developers like us. We live and breathe REST. Nothing gets us more excited than delivering an API experience that lets developers do something they’ve never done before. And, with 700,000+ developers building applications on Twilio, those APIs have a huge impact.


The API team at Twilio is responsible for helping to design the REST APIs for all of Twilio’s product lines, from SMS to IP Communications. We also build the helper libraries that 90% of our customers use to access the APIs. Ease of use and consistency are top of mind; we pride ourselves on getting new developers up and running with Twilio in less than 5 minutes.  Finally, the API Team owns and operates the API layer itself - a high-availability, low-latency machine that processes more than 3 billion API requests a month.

Engineering Manager - Full Stack at Twilio (San Francisco, CA)

$
0
0

The Twilio platform enables companies to integrate communications directly into their applications via simple cloud API’s and with on-demand global reach.  Twilio is therefore challenged with abstracting away a world of complexity so that our customers can go global without concern for managing a global communications network, carrier integrations and relationships throughout the world.


About the job:


As Manager in the Carrier Services organization, you will lead by guiding the engineering team through the implementation of real-time voice services using Java and C++ while leveraging standards such as SIP, RTP, WebRTC and HTTP.  To take it to scale, you will be managing a complex distributed platform with points of presence globally and will be concerned with availability, throughput, latency, media fidelity as well as real-time considerations. There will be some data components so you will be working with distributed SQL and NoSQL databases and caches.  At the core are cloud technologies that enable deployment and management of computing resources globally.
